Learning about the Issues of Wildlife in Your Home
Wildlife inside the home presents considerable risks that numerous homeowners might underestimate. Uninvited creatures often cause extensive property damage, necessitating costly repairs. For copyrightple, rodents can gnaw on electrical wiring, raising the risk of fires. Moreover, their droppings can contaminate food and surfaces, creating significant health hazards.
Additionally, animal life can bring in pest organisms, like fleas and ticks, which can impact both humans and pets. The occurrence of larger animals, like raccoons or deer, can also cause aggressive encounters, jeopardizing residents.
The nesting patterns of various species may cause structural damage, as they can obstruct ventilation or create entry points for additional pest invasions. Common Rodent Invaders
While many homeowners may not understand it, typical rodent pests such as mice and rats can pose serious dangers to both health and home. Mice, typically more nimble and compact, can easily infiltrate homes through tiny openings. They often nest in attics, walls, or basements, resulting in potential damage and contamination. Rats, additional information on the other hand, are larger and more destructive, capable of chewing into insulation and wiring, which may result in costly repairs. Both species are known for transmitting illnesses, such as hantavirus and leptospirosis, rendering them a significant health risk. Nocturnal Pest Identification
What are the ways property owners can effectively detect the signs of nighttime pests that may invade their living spaces? Recognition of these intruders often starts with noticing odd sounds at night, including scratching or scurrying. Frequent nocturnal pests include raccoons, opossums, and various rodents. Homeowners should look for droppings, chew marks on wires or furniture, and claw marks near entries. Furthermore, nests found in attics or basements might indicate an infestation. Strange odors can also signal the presence of these pests. What Takes Place During Wildlife Extraction?
During animal extraction, qualified technicians inspect the situation to determine the most suitable approach for safely and humanely dealing with the presence of pests. This initial assessment includes identifying the animal species, the magnitude of the outbreak, and potential entry points into the dwelling.
After the assessment is complete, the specialists formulate a tailored plan that prioritizes the well-being of both the creatures and the inhabitants. They may apply devices or prevention techniques to capture or deter the wildlife without causing harm.
In many cases, technicians also provide suggestions for preventing subsequent pest problems, such as closing access holes or removing food sources. After the removal, the area is sanitized and restored as required to minimize the risk of further animal entry.

What is the typical cost of wildlife removal?
Animal control costs usually range from $100 to $1,500, subject to factors like the type of animal, the magnitude of the outbreak, and the difficulty of the extraction procedure required for secure and compassionate removal.

Can I Stop Animals From Getting Into My Home?
To keep animals from entering a home, one should close cracks, protect vents, and properly store food. Regularly checking the property for access areas and keeping a tidy yard can further deter potential intruders.
